Public Service Broadcasting's 'Go!' Gets Remixed
. (Prog) Public Service Broadcasting have released a stream of their single Go! as remixed by Errors. The variant version is described as a "spectral disco" take on the track from second album The Race For Space. The Race For Space, which follows 2013 debut Inform - Educate - Entertain, was released last month via Test Card Recordings. A video for the original version of Go! was also launched last month. Mastermind J Willgoose Esq said of the album: "I find it a particularly sad indictment of our species that arguably our greatest technological and spiritual achievement - leaving our own planet and walking on another celestial body - is viewed by the more cynical as a colossal waste of money or, worse, as the greatest hoax ever perpetuated."
